Skip To Content

Gérer les déploiements à l’aide de ArcGIS Enterprise Cloud Builder CLI for AWS

Vous pouvez utiliser les commandes suivantes pour gérer un déploiement que vous avez créé avec ArcGIS Enterprise Cloud Builder Command Line Interface for Amazon Web Services.

Syntaxe de la ligne de commande

Voici la syntaxe à utiliser pour chacune des commandes décrites sur cette page. La syntaxe des options d’aide et de version disponibles avec ArcGIS Enterprise Cloud Builder CLI for AWS est également indiquée.

  • Cloudbuilder.exe LIST --aws-access-key <access key> --aws-secret-access-key <secret access key> ou Cloudbuilder.exe LIST --aws-profile-name <aws profile name>
  • Cloudbuilder.exe STOP -d <deployment name> --aws-access-key <access key> --aws-secret-access-key <secret access key> ou Cloudbuilder.exe STOP -d <deployment name> --aws-profile-name <aws profile name>
  • Cloudbuilder.exe START -d <deployment name> --aws-access-key <access key> --aws-secret-access-key <secret access key> ou Cloudbuilder.exe START -d <deployment name> --aws-profile-name <aws profile name>
  • Cloudbuilder.exe DELETE -d <deployment name> --aws-access-key <access key> --aws-secret-access-key <secret access key> ou Cloudbuilder.exe DELETE -d <deployment name> --aws-profile-name <aws profile name>
  • Cloudbuilder.exe {-v | --version}
  • Cloudbuilder.exe {-h | --help}

Répertorier les déploiements

La commande LIST renvoie des informations sur tous les déploiements que vous avez créés avec ArcGIS Enterprise Cloud Builder for Amazon Web Services pour le compte Amazon Web Services (AWS) que vous spécifiez. Vous pouvez utiliser ces informations pour gérer vos déploiements à l’aide de commandes telles que STOP, START et DELETE, décrites dans les sections suivantes.

Pour obtenir des informations sur les déploiements disponibles, procédez comme suit :

  1. Ouvrez une interface de ligne de commande Windows.
  2. Accédez au dossier dans lequel ArcGIS Enterprise Cloud Builder for AWS est installé.
  3. Exécutez le fichier exécutable Cloud Builder à l’aide de la commande LIST.

    La syntaxe est la suivante :

    Cloudbuilder.exe LIST {--aws-access-key <myaccesskey> --aws-secret-access-key <mysecretaccesskey> | --aws-profile-name <myawsprofilename>}

    La commande répertorie le nom du déploiement, la région AWS, la version ArcGIS et le statut du déploiement.

Arrêter les machines d’un déploiement

La commande STOP arrête toutes les machines Amazon Elastic Compute Cloud (EC2) qui composent un déploiement. Il est possible d’arrêter les machines EC2 inutilisées, et ainsi réaliser des économies, mais uniquement si personne n’a besoin d’utiliser le déploiement.

Pour arrêter toutes les instances d’un déploiement particulier, procédez comme suit :

  1. Ouvrez une interface de ligne de commande Windows.
  2. Accédez au dossier dans lequel ArcGIS Enterprise Cloud Builder for AWS est installé.
  3. Exécutez le fichier exécutable Cloud Builder à l’aide de la commande STOP, en indiquant le nom du déploiement à arrêter.

    La syntaxe est la suivante :

    Cloudbuilder.exe STOP -d <mydeploymentname> {--aws-access-key <myaccesskey> --aws-secret-access-key <mysecretaccesskey> | --aws-profile-name <myawsprofilename>}

    Utilisez la commande LIST pour obtenir le nom du déploiement. Les noms de déploiement sont sensibles à la casse. Vous pouvez arrêter uniquement un déploiement dont le statut est Completed (Terminé) et l’état est Started (Démarré).

    La commande arrête toutes les machines du déploiement indiqué.

Démarrer les machines d’un déploiement

Après avoir arrêté les machines EC2 d’un déploiement à l’aide de la commande STOP, vous pouvez utiliser la commande START pour les redémarrer.

Pour démarrer toutes les instances d’un déploiement particulier, procédez comme suit :

  1. Ouvrez une interface de ligne de commande Windows.
  2. Accédez au dossier dans lequel ArcGIS Enterprise Cloud Builder for AWS est installé.
  3. Exécutez le fichier exécutable Cloud Builder à l’aide de la commande START, en indiquant le nom du déploiement à démarrer.

    La syntaxe est la suivante :

    Cloudbuilder.exe START -d <mydeploymentname> {--aws-access-key <myaccesskey> --aws-secret-access-key <mysecretaccesskey> | --aws-profile-name <myawsprofilename>}

    Les noms de déploiement sont sensibles à la casse. Vous pouvez démarrer uniquement un déploiement dont l’état est Stopped (Arrêté).

    La commande démarre toutes les machines EC2 du déploiement indiqué.

Supprimer un déploiement

Pour supprimer le déploiement ArcGIS Enterprise sur Amazon Web Services (AWS) qui a été créé avec l’utilitaire ArcGIS Enterprise Cloud Builder Command Line Interface for Amazon Web Services, utilisez la commande DELETE.

La commande DELETE supprime toutes les ressources que vous avez créées à l’aide de la commande CREATE, y compris les piles AWS CloudFormation, les journaux CloudWatch, les enregistrements issus de AWS Route 53 (si vous avez indiqué un AWSRoute53ZoneID), ainsi que le paquet Amazon Simple Storage Service (S3) et la table DynamoDB de votre répertoire cloud (si vous avez spécifié cette option pour StoreType). Cette opération ne peut pas être annulée.

Remarque :

La commande DELETE est prise en charge uniquement pour les déploiements créés à l’aide de la commande CREATE de ArcGIS Enterprise Cloud Builder CLI for AWS. Elle ne permet pas de supprimer les ressources créées avec la commande PREP.